and matzah. cambier means that Allah is glorious.
That Allah deserves to brag about his powers and boast about what he's able to do. This is one of those names that
it shows us aside of something that would not be okay if we did it.
It's different from something like Allah's mercy.
Allah is the Most Merciful. And when we're merciful, that's a good thing. Well, this is the opposite. Allah is Allah multicam.
He is the one who has the most glory, and has the rights and deserves to boast or brag because he's perfect. And he's able to do anything that he wants. He created all of us. He made the heavens and the stars and the planets. He made the mountains. And he gave us beautiful things in this life, like our food, and our homes, and our toys.
But as for us, we don't really deserve to brag or boast about anything.
Maybe if you've ever played sports, you've seen other children doing this. Maybe they score a goal, or they make a basket
or they win something and they start to brag. They say I'm the best. I'm better than everyone. No one can beat me.
When people act like this, it's not a good thing.
Because every ability that we have, at the end of the day, it's because Allah gave it to us.
And if Allah wants, he can take that ability away from us, just as easily as he gave it to us.
